What Are Water Tables and Sand Tables?

A water table is a raised table with a shallow basin designed to hold water. It may include pumps, waterfalls, wheels, funnels, scoops, cups, measuring spoons, toy boats, and floating creatures. Children can pour water from one container to another, watch it spin a water wheel, or simply let their hands move through it. Water tables are often used both indoors and outdoors, and the water can be changed quickly, allowing for themes such as ocean exploration, car washing, or bubble play.

A sand table, by contrast, is filled with sand instead of water. The sand can be dry, moist, or kinetic. The table typically includes scoops, shovels, buckets, molds, rakes, and miniature animals or vehicles. Children can dig, bury, build, and shape the sand. The material offers more resistance than water, so it demands more muscle work and yields more sculptural results. Some classrooms use a combined “sand and water table” with two separate basins, but the individual experiences remain distinct.

Sensory and Learning Benefits

When water tables compared with sand tables are considered in terms of sensory input, both are rich, but they stimulate different senses. Water is fluid, cool, and changeable. It provides visual and auditory feedback through ripples, splashes, and the sound of pouring. Children learn about volume, capacity, and conservation by pouring from a tall narrow cup into a wide shallow dish. They observe objects that float or sink and experiment with flow and resistance. Water play can be deeply calming; the repetitive motion of scooping and pouring helps many children regulate their emotions.

Sand, on the other hand, is tactile in a more textured way. Dry sand runs through fingers with a soft, granular feeling; wet sand holds its shape and can be molded into castles, tunnels, and intricate roads. Sand play encourages spatial thinking and engineering language. Children learn about cause and effect when they add water to dry sand and watch it change from crumbly to packable. They also experience the physical properties of matter more directly because sand has weight and friction. While water is continuously moving, sand allows for construction, destruction, and reconstruction. This makes sand tables especially valuable for imaginative play and problem-solving.

Physical and Motor Skill Development

Motor skills are another area where water tables and sand tables diverge. Water play exercises fine motor skills, especially the small muscles in the hands and fingers. Squeezing a rubber duck, pinching a cup handle, turning a spout, and aiming a stream of water all require careful coordination. However, water offers little resistance, so children do not need to use much force. This makes a water table a good choice for younger children or those with weaker muscle tone.

Sand play, in contrast, provides a mild but meaningful workout. Digging, lifting, scooping, and patting sand strengthen the larger muscles of the arms and shoulders. Molding wet sand in a fist develops grip strength. Raking and smoothing involve bilateral coordination, where both sides of the body work together. Because sand resists motion, children must adjust their effort, which helps them learn about proprioceptive feedback—the sense of where their body is in space. In this regard, sand tables offer more physical challenge than water tables.

Social and Emotional Play Patterns

Observing children at play reveals different social dynamics. A water table often encourages parallel and cooperative play. Several children can stand around the table, pour water in the same direction, and share floating toys without too much conflict. Water is abundant and easy to share. The sensation is soothing, and many children engage in calm, repetitive actions. Water tables can be especially helpful for children who are anxious or overwhelmed, as the gentle sensory input helps them focus.

Sand tables also invite group play, but with more negotiation. Because sand can be built into structures, children may claim territories: “This is my castle,” or “Do not touch my road.” Such conflicts are not necessarily bad. They provide opportunities for children to practice sharing, waiting, and using words to express needs. Sand play also fosters more elaborate dramatic play. A group of children might decide to make a farm, a construction site, or a dinosaur world, assigning roles and coordinating actions. When water tables compared with sand tables in this way, sand tables tend to produce more sustained collaborative storytelling, while water tables tend to produce more open-ended, flowing experimentation.

Mess, Safety, and Maintenance

No discussion of water tables and sand tables is complete without honest attention to mess. Water tables create wet floors, damp sleeves, and puddles. Children may slip, and adults need mops and towels nearby. Water also requires careful safety consideration. Even a few centimeters of water can be dangerous for toddlers, so an adult must always be within arm’s reach. Additionally, water can become contaminated with germs, especially if shared among many children. It should be emptied and sanitized regularly, which adds a maintenance burden.

Sand tables create a different kind of mess. Sand sticks to hands, clothes, and hair. It finds its way into pockets, shoes, and crevices. Dry sand can be dusty, and wet sand may attract mold if left damp. The table itself requires periodic cleaning, and the sand should be raked and inspected for debris. However, sand does not create a slipping hazard in the same way as water, and there is no drowning risk. The main dangers are sand in the eyes and mouth. Children must learn not to throw sand. Because sand is heavier and less mobile than water, it is often easier to contain.

Choosing Between the Two

So which one is better? The answer depends on the situation. For a hot summer day outdoors, a water table is refreshing and exciting. It is unmatched for teaching early science concepts such as sinking, floating, and the movement of liquids. For a classroom or therapy setting where calm and focus are needed, a water table can be a soothing retreat.

A sand table is a wiser choice when the goal is building, pretending, and cooperative construction. It is also more convenient in colder months, since it can be used indoors without the need for draining and refilling. Kinetic sand or lightly moistened sand reduces dust and makes cleanup easier. Many educators choose to offer both, either on alternate days or in separate corners of the room. In that way, children who prefer the fluid calm of water and those who prefer the tactile challenge of sand can each find what they need.
